Job Details

Role: Network Infrastructure Architect/Engineer.
Location: Baltimore, MD/Woodlawn, MD (Remote Temporarily).

Job Description:
DNS/IPAM; Firewalls; NAC; load balancing; DDoS mitigation, tapping/sniffing infrastructures; NTP; AWS (Preferred), Azure, or Google Cloud, WAN, LAN, IPv6, TCP/IP, VPN, Ethernet Skills; EIGRP, BGP4, RIP, VPLS, MPLS; Active Cisco CCIE certification.
Research, design, and implement security solutions for network infrastructure.
Engineer network solutions for new & existing systems.
Provide day-to-day network engineering and operations support.
Provide tactical and strategic input on overall network planning and related projects.
Work with advanced technical principles, theories, and concepts.
Challenge with working on complex technical problems and providing innovative solutions.
Work with highly experienced technical resources.
All other duties as assigned or directed.
Attending customer lab environment to work with new technologies and applications.

Basic Qualifications:
Minimum knowledge, skills, and abilities needed.
10 years of experience with designing, configuring, managing, maintaining, and troubleshooting network switching and routing protocols in a large enterprise network (7000+ nodes).
8 years of experience with configuring and managing switches, routers, Load Balancers, and firewalls.
8 years of experience with Network Monitoring/IPAM (i.e., SolarWinds, NetFlow).
8 years of physical communication troubleshooting skills using cabling and signaling analyzer, packet capture, and analysis.
8 years of experience and knowledge of Cisco IOS and Cisco Nexus Operating systems.
8 years of experience with WAN Optimization using Riverbed and trace tools like Wireshark.
5 years of experience with high-level scripting languages, such as Python or Perl.
5 years of experience with Gigamon.
Active Cisco CCIE, CCNP certification, IPv6, and PRIME experience.
Experience with Dynatrace.
Solid understanding of internetworking: security, routing, switching, SAN, and application networking.
Experience with Microsoft Server and Linux Administration.
Expertise in the Linux command-line environment.
High availability, failover, and redundant configurations
Network deployment and operations automation (Ansible, Zero Touch Provisioning).
Experience with virtualization solutions (i.e., VMWare).
Experience documenting network information including of all switching and routing equipment, connected IP addressable devices and cabling interconnects.
Provide technical competence for auditing the existing environment by creating relevant documentation where it does not exist.
Plan, research, evaluate, design, and develop network systems by applying engineering, hardware, and software design theories and principles to develop a compatible system infrastructure in line with organization strategies.
Interface with customer IT leadership and internal teams to develop network, systems, and security solutions.
Ability to produce operational documentation using industry best practices in technical writing.
Experience in using MS Visio, Project.
Strong cloud networking & design experience preferably with Hyperscalers like AWS, Azure, and Google.
Must be able to obtain and maintain a US Public Trust clearance.
